Rc endpoint for hashsum --download

What is the problem you are having with rclone?

I am trying to use the rc interface to do the equivalent of hashsum --download. I can get hashes with operations/stat or operations/list but I can't make it download.

I could do it manually either by downloading the file copyfile or by reading it on the remote with --rc-serve and streaming the http file but then I need to work out optimizations around blocksizes, etc. It would be nice if I could leverage the existing logic in rclone.

Run the command 'rclone version' and share the full output of the command.

rclone v1.65.1
- os/version: darwin 14.2.1 (64 bit)
- os/kernel: 23.2.0 (arm64)
- os/type: darwin
- os/arch: arm64 (ARMv8 compatible)
- go/version: go1.21.5
- go/linking: dynamic
- go/tags: cmount

Which cloud storage system are you using? (eg Google Drive)

Any that doesn't support hashes. E.g. crypt

The command you were trying to run (eg rclone copy /tmp remote:tmp)

hashsum --download via rc

